Principal Software Engineer integrating partner accelerator hardware and Red Hat's open-source software stack. Collaborating across teams to optimize AI workloads and enhance system integration.
Responsibilities
Assist with integration of partner accelerator hardware (GPUs, DPUs) into the Red Hat ecosystem
Build and optimize solutions using KVM, QEMU, and libvirt
Design and implement robust networking paths using Advanced Software Defined Network (SDN) and Virtual Networking
Act as the technical bridge between hardware-level drivers and cloud-native platforms like Kubernetes and Red Hat OpenShift
Develop integration patterns and 'well lit paths' for AI workloads
Work closely with Product Engineering, Partners, and Customers to root-cause complex issues across the entire stack
Create architectural blueprints and implementation guides for field engineers and lighthouse customers
Explore and experiment with emerging AI technologies relevant to software development
Requirements
7+ years of experience in system integration, infrastructure engineering, or specialized DevOps
Deep practical knowledge of server virtualization technology (ESX, Hyper-V, KVM)
Strong understanding of Software Defined Networking (SDN) concepts
Hands-on experience with Kubernetes, Podman, or Docker
Advanced proficiency in Linux system administration, kernel modules, and hardware-software interfaces
Ability to work closely with diverse teams and translate complex hardware requirements into software-defined solutions
Excellent system understanding and troubleshooting capabilities
Proficient written and verbal communication skills in English
Benefits
Comprehensive medical, dental, and vision coverage
Flexible Spending Account - healthcare and dependent care
Health Savings Account - high deductible medical plan
Retirement 401(k) with employer match
Paid time off and holidays
Paid parental leave plans for all new parents
Leave benefits including disability, paid family medical leave, and paid military leave
Additional benefits including employee stock purchase plan, family planning reimbursement, tuition reimbursement, transportation expense account, employee assistance program, and more!
Director of Software Engineering developing next - generation technology impacting philanthropic goals at Fidelity Charitable. Involves hands - on development and leading a high - functioning Agile team.
Software Engineering Intern developing innovative solutions for new equipment and machine upgrades. Collaborating with engineers and focusing on hands - on engineering work in a team - based environment.
Full - Stack Developer building scalable web applications using React.js and Python frameworks at Expleo. Collaborating with designers and developers to deliver high - quality software solutions.
Software Engineer delivering features and fixing issues in an engineering team for eCommerce automation leader. Engaging in quality collaboration and proactively contributing to team improvement.
UI Senior Software Engineer developing modern web applications for S&P Global Mobility. Collaborating with cross - functional teams to enhance user experience and maintain high - quality delivery.
Principal Engineer in HBM Design - Technology Enablement at Micron Technology, focusing on semiconductor design and mentoring. Collaborating on HBM design/product roadmaps and addressing scaling challenges.
Software Developer (BI with Qlik Sense/View) focused on operational support at Hitss. Engaging in data integration, performance monitoring, and user assistance.
Lead Software Engineer overseeing software engineering practices at Capgemini. Applying scientific methods to solve software engineering problems and responsible for the development of software solutions.
Software Engineer developing, maintaining, and optimizing software solutions/applications at Capgemini. Collaborating with other engineers and solving complex software problems in a team environment.
Staff Engineer, Hardware Design developing electrical systems for product development at Celestica. Leading technical solutions for complex projects involving cross - functional teams in multiple domains.